>웹 프론트엔드 >프런트엔드 Q&A >jquery를 교체해야 합니까?

jquery를 교체해야 합니까?

PHPz
PHPz원래의
2023-04-17 11:28:36627검색

웹 기술의 지속적인 발전에 따라 프런트엔드 프레임워크와 라이브러리도 끊임없이 등장하고 있습니다. 그중 jquery는 가장 널리 사용되는 프론트엔드 라이브러리 중 하나입니다. 그런데 웹 기술과 브라우저의 업그레이드로 원래 영원히 널리 사용될 것으로 생각되었던 jquery를 교체해야 할까요? 이 기사에서는 jquery와 대체 도구의 장단점, 그리고 jquery를 교체해야 하는 경우를 살펴보겠습니다.

먼저 jquery의 장점을 살펴보겠습니다. jquery의 가장 큰 장점은 단순성, 사용 용이성 및 메소드 호환성입니다. 다양한 브라우저 간의 호환성 문제를 해결하도록 설계되어 프런트 엔드 개발자가 브라우저 간 JavaScript 코드를 더 쉽게 작성할 수 있습니다. jquery의 구문은 간단하고 이해하기 쉽고 관용적이므로 개발자는 번거로운 기본 JavaScript에서 벗어날 수 있습니다. 또한 jquery는 프런트엔드 개발자가 일부 일반적인 작업을 더 빠르게 완료할 수 있도록 수많은 플러그인을 제공합니다.

그러나 웹 기술의 발전과 JS 언어 자체의 지속적인 개선으로 인해 jquery의 원래 장점은 점차 다른 최신 라이브러리로 대체되었습니다. 예를 들어 React 및 Vue.js와 같은 프레임워크는 보다 완벽한 구성 요소 솔루션을 제공하므로 개발자는 복잡한 애플리케이션을 보다 쉽게 ​​관리할 수 있습니다. 또한 ES6의 함수형 프로그래밍 스타일을 사용하면 기본 JavaScript를 더 쉽고 효율적으로 작성할 수 있습니다. 프런트 엔드 라이브러리를 선택할 때 js 구문의 우아함만 고려한다면 React 및 Vue.js와 같은 최신 라이브러리는 jquery보다 장점이 있습니다.

그런데 기존 프로젝트에서 jquery를 교체해야 할까요? 이는 사용 시나리오와 비즈니스 요구 사항을 고려하여 고려해야 합니다.

우선, 소규모 웹사이트를 구축하고 몇 가지 기본적인 대화형 효과만 달성해야 한다면 의심할 여지 없이 jquery가 최선의 선택입니다. jquery가 제공하는 것은 다른 브라우저 간 및 고성능 문제에 대해 너무 많이 생각할 필요 없이 간단하고 빠른 프로그래밍 방법입니다.

대규모 단일 페이지 애플리케이션이나 데스크톱 수준 웹 애플리케이션을 개발하는 경우 jquery로는 충분하지 않습니다. 이때 jquery를 대체하기 위해 React, Vue 등과 같은 좀 더 현대적인 라이브러리나 프런트엔드 프레임워크를 선택할 수 있습니다. 이러한 라이브러리와 프레임워크는 보다 강력한 상태 관리, 구성 요소 솔루션 및 완전한 생태계를 제공하여 복잡한 비즈니스 요구 사항으로 인해 발생하는 문제를 더 잘 해결하는 데 도움이 될 수 있습니다.

요약하자면, jquery는 적용 가능한 시나리오 내에서 여전히 매우 훌륭한 도구입니다. 다양한 비즈니스 시나리오에 직면하면 jquery와 기타 최신 라이브러리 중에서 선택하고 균형을 맞춘 후 가장 적합한 솔루션을 선택해야 합니다. 맹목적으로 최신 기술을 추구해서는 안 되며, 구체적인 상황에 따라 합리적인 선택을 해야 합니다.

위 내용은 jquery를 교체해야 합니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.